Downtown Open brings free 19-hole mini golf course to Downtown Huntsville

HUNTSVILLE, Ala. (WHNT) — The next few days will bring gorgeous temperatures to the Tennessee Valley, and what better way to enjoy it than by spending some time Downtown? If you’re looking for a fun and free activity, you’re in luck!

Downtown Huntsville, Inc. is partnering with GFiber to put on the Downtown Open. It’s a free 19-hole mini golf course scattered around the Courthouse Square in Huntsville.

Each hole has been decorated by a different Huntsville business.

Anna Rojas, with Downtown Huntsville, Inc., said the idea for the course is to give people a fun and free activity downtown.

“We always encourage our local community to come out and explore downtown Huntsville,” Rojas said.

The event is returning this year, and Rojas said it is perfect for all ages.

“I see a lot of families come out and play, and have their own little mini tournaments,” she said. “I see a lot of our young professionals as well.”

She suggests making an evening or afternoon out of it. “Grab a purple cup, enjoy our downtown district,” Rojas said.

You can pick up (and return) a scorecard, balls, and clubs at Honest Coffee, BeeZr, or One Man’s Vintage during business hours. Rojas said with their wide range of hours, you can play whatever time of day or evening that you’d like!

The Downtown Open officially kicks off on Saturday, April 19, and runs through Wednesday, April 30.
